Death's Love
If I were to die I would want to see an angel beforehand. Death’s love is nothing spectacular Just someone to hold my hand An angel of beauty and galore That all the animals adore If I were to die I would want to see an angel Beforehand. Death’s love is Something spectacular Just someone to move my hand An angel of malevolence and galore That all the rodents hated before If I were to die, why would I want to see an angel beforehand? Death’s love is someone to tease me Someone to love me Death’s love is all confusing Close the door. Slam and shut. If I were to die, I still would want to see an angel Beforehand. Beauty, mutiny Does not matter As I sat near the platter So many choices So many voices If I were to die I would want to see an angel Beforehand Banning deaths love Might be the way I can understand So you can see the eyes of what you have not seen You never saw it But you know it's as bright as the light behind my eyes. As I’m about to die. Death’s love they call it Is something that never flies. It only falls Up to the sky
